Old French fabliaux are a genre of brief, often humorous and satirical, narrative poems popular in France during the 12th and 13th centuries. These medieval French tales typically featured common folk, explored themes of trickery, folly, and often contained a moral or an anti-moral, providing a unique insight into medieval society and its often ribald sensibilities.
